THELIA Forum

Welcome to the THELIA support and discusssion forum

Announcement

Rejoignez la communauté sur le Discord Thelia : https://discord.gg/YgwpYEE3y3

Offline


Bonjour

pour tester Thélia2 (en local) j'aimerai bien insérer les produit de démo, mais j'avoue que je ne comprends pas trés bien ce qu'il faut faire pour les installer ?

Dans la doc, je lis ca :

How to insert fake data ?

For a demo with fake but realistic products

$ php setup/import.php

For dev data

$ php setup/faker.php

(composer must be install globally)

Ok mais où dois-je insérer ces lignes ? Est ce que ca se passe via la BO, ou sur un fichier ???

Merci d'éclairer ma lanterne de néophyte

ps : euh, c'est quoi composer ? est ce qu'il faut l'installer, comment ?

Last edited by Madrilene (20-08-2014 17:46:32)

Offline


Je me réponds (en lien avec la piste qui m'a été donnée par Roadster31 dans un autre  post)

Quand on est en local (perso j'ai installé Easyphp...) , qu'on a installé Thélia 2 pour remplir la boutique avec des produits factices, il faut activer le serveur (je lance donc Easyphp) puis lancer la console MS DOS (moi je suis sous XP : menu Démarrer -> Executer ).
Puis changer le chemin CD : C:\là on écrit le chemin qui mene à thélia 2 via Easyphp, jusqu'au répertoire qui contient le répertoire "setup", pui on ecrit la commande php setup\faker.php et les tables etc... se créent et les données factices "rentrent dans la BDD de la boutique" !

Voila si ca peut servir à d'autres...

Last edited by Madrilene (20-08-2014 10:53:50)

Offline


Bon alors du côté de la console tout semble s'être bien passé mais du côté site euh comment dirais-je... les images ne s'affichent pas sur le template par défaut.
Sur la page d'accueil j'ai l'image du slide, et en dessous en orange en dessous de LATEST <img itemprop="image"
le lien VIEW ALL
et c'est tout

Quand je clique sur VIEW all dans le menu j'ai une série assez longue de titres commençant pas en_US: puis du latin style Repellat architecto. mais quand je clique dessus il ne se passe rien, si ce n'est que s'affiche une mention du style "14 elements" et du vide en dessous...


J'aimerai bien revenir au back office mais je ne sais pas comment on fait en Thélia2 ? Quelle est l'adresse ?

Bref je pédale dans la semoule...

Merci d'avance

Offline


Désolée j'ai oublié de préciser que j'étais en local

Du coup j'ai tenté:
http://127.0.0.1/projects/thelia2/web/admin

Tout a l'heure ca marchait pas et là ca marche (j'ai du faire une erreur de frappe, au temps pour moi)

Merci
[AJOUT la catastrophe ne fait que commencer]

Bon alors la commande php a marché en tout cas tout s'est bien déroulé a l'écran de la console.

MAIS depuis rien ne va plus dans ma Thelia2 local.

1) aprés l'install, j'ai regardé l'affichage, la mise en page était complètement "éclatée" (en particulier les images du carrousel qui sont les unes a la suite des autres en hauteur), ensuite aucune image  des produits factices n'apparaissait a l'écran alors qu'elles existaient dans la BDD
Affichage des titres mais aussi de marqueur de langue style EN-

2) j'ai décidé de supprimer la BDD via php my admin, j'ai foutu à la poubelle les fichiers thélia et je suis repartie pour une nouvelle installe. Dans mon souvenir, je crois que ca s'affichait pas trop mal.J'ai décidé de sursoir a l'installation des produits factices qui semblait mettre le bazar. Du coup j'ai essayé de créer un prod en back office. Et là impossible de joindre une image. Erreur 403
J'ai pensé que ça venait des paramétrages que la doc décrit. J'ai fini par vaguement comprendre que le paramétrage proposé par la doc sur hostvirtual devrait s'insérer dans le fichier de conf du serveur apache.

J'ai copié collé le truc du site thelia dans ce fichier en essayant d'adapter le nom du chemin. J'ai fait un essais qui ne devait pas etre bon car message d'erreur des que je pointait vers web. Du coup j'ai enlevé ce que j'avais fait. Là je retombe sur la boutique, mais la mise en page est inexistante (proche du cas décrit en 1)

J'ai vidé tous les caches de thélia2 via admin et j'ai nettoyé le navigateur avec Ccleaner mais c'est toujours le même affichage qui revient...

3) je me dis que je vais encore une fois tout effacer et recommencer
Là j'ai un mise ne page tout aussi éclaté mais sont apparus des titres sans image style produit démo 99 euros !
J'ai regardé la base de donnée je ne retrouve pas les tables des produits de démo de la première installe des produits factices.

Je crois que j'ai décrit toutes les manipes que j'ai faites.

Je suis sous XP, derniere version de easyphp developer, j'ai un dossier thelia 1 avec sa base de donnée propre qui à part le fait que je n'arrive pas à activer la fonction mail a l'air de marcher nickel.
Ca fait quasi une semaine que j'essaye d'installer et de remplir correctement Thelia 2 avec entre autre les produits factices. Je crois que Thelia 2 va me tuer si ca continue. Bref AU SECOURS ! est ce que je dois tout réinstaller y compris easyphp ? Est ce que je dois supprimer le thélia1 ?

J'ai l'impression a lire les messages du forum que je suis la seule à vivre une véritable galère et a ne pas arriver à faire fonctionner cette version de thélia  ? Ou alors c'est que les gens qui teste cette version sont des technicien(ne)s avec un certain bagage et que tout les novices se sont découragés et ne poste pas ???

Si quelqu'un a un peu de temps pour se pencher sur mon cas, franchement ca serait une délivrance dans ce qui commence à ressembler à un calvaire.

Last edited by Madrilene (21-08-2014 21:39:47)